    Who we are:
    The Oxford Seniors Community Adult Day Service (ADS) is designed to provide a supervision and support for older adults with cognitive or physical needs in a small group setting. We are open M-F from 8:30-4:30.

    Participants may be experiencing memory impairment or physical limitations which isolate them from the greater community.

    Participants find a secure environment, fun activities, and opportunity to socialize. Activities are focused on cognitive skills and healthy meals and snacks are provided. The atmosphere is one of acceptance and encouragement.

    Goals of Community Adult Day Service
    • To facilitate a level of independence for participants
    • To provide respite and support for caregivers
    • To enable participants to remain at home with their families for as long as possible
